I have a pair of speakers I am using in my boat that are 8 ohm (300 watt max) Evid 6.2's, I have a an MB Quartz 4200 amp that does 100 x 4 at 4 ohms. Should I run the speakers in parrallel to get the amp to see a 4 ohm load and minimize work on the amp and or should I bridge the amp down to 2 channels? Ideally I would like to run a sub and the tower speakers off of this singe amp. At 8 ohms the amp should give you 50 watts which is kinda low for a noisy boat, but it gives you the other 2 channels available for subs. Try it and see if its loud enough. If not, bridge it to 2 channels.
